Introduction to Retro Gaming
Defining Retro Games
Retro games are typically defined as titles released in the late 20th century. These games evoke a sense of nostalgia. Many players fondly remember their childhood experiences. It’s fascinating how these games shaped the industry. They often feature pixelated graphics and simple mechanics. Simplicity can be refreshing in today’s complex games. Retro gaming has seen a resurgence in popularity. People are drawn to the charm of the past. It’s a wonderful way to connect with history. Classic titles often inspire modern game design. Innovation can stem from tradition.

Challenges in Reviving Classic Games
Licensing and Legal Issues
Licensing and legal issues present significant challenges in reviving classic games. He observes that securing rights can be complex and costly. This complexity often deters developers from pursuing remakes. Additionally, intellectual property disputes can arise unexpectedly. These factors can impact financial viability. He notes that navigating these legal landscapes requires expertise. It’s crucial for developers to conduct thorough research. Understanding the implications can save resources. Legal clarity fosters smoother project execution.
Maintaining Original Charm vs. Modernization
Maintaining the original charm of classic games while modernizing them poses significant challenges. He notes that players often have strong emotional attachments to the original versions. Balancing nostalgia with contemporary expectations can be difficult. Developers must decide which elements to preserve. This decision impacts player satisfaction and market reception. He believes that careful consideration is essential. Striking the right balance can enhance engagement. It’s a delicate process that requires insight. Fans appreciate authenticity in their gaming experiences.
